Copper mining and mill analyses by γ-rays from capture of californium-252 neutrons

Abstract:Copper mill materials from Utah and Nevada and rock cores from a geothermal drill hole at the Valies Grande Caldera in New Mexico were irradiated at the Los Alamos Scientific Laboratory with neutrons from a californium-252 source (about 1010 n s-1), and the capture γ-rays were measured. The copper response, based on the 6.89-MeV double escape line, agreed sufficiently well with the known chemical composition of the materials to indicate usefulness of this technique for exploring copper deposits and for monitoring metallurgical extraction processes.
